What color furniture goes best with grey flooring?
There are a few different schools of thought when it comes to matching furniture with grey flooring. Some people believe that contrasting colors create the most visually appealing look, while others prefer to stick to a more monochromatic color scheme. Ultimately, it comes down to personal preference and what looks best in your space.
If you prefer a more traditional look, you might gravitate towards using darker furniture pieces with your grey floors. Black, brown, and deep shades of red or blue can provide a stately look in a living room or dining room. If you want to add a pop of color, you could use lighter accents like chairs or throw pillows in a bright hue.
If you prefer a more modern look, you might want to use white or light-colored furniture with your grey floors. This can create a sleek and contemporary feel in your space. You can also experiment with different shades of grey in your furniture to create a gradient effect.
No matter what style you choose, there are a few general guidelines you should follow when pairing furniture with grey flooring. Avoid using pieces that are too small or too large for the space - they will look out of proportion and throw off the whole look. Make sure to leave enough negative space around your furniture so that it doesn't look cramped. And finally, pay attention to the finish of your furniture - it should complement the finish of your floors.

What color area rug should I use with grey flooring?
There's no one-size-fits-all answer to this question, as the best color area rug to use with grey flooring will vary depending on the specific shade of grey and the overall style of the room. However, we can offer some general guidelines to help you choose the perfect area rug for your space.
If you have light grey floors, a dark area rug will create a dramatic contrast that can really make your room pop. Alternatively, if you want a more subtle look, you can choose a rug that's only a few shades darker than your flooring. For dark grey floors, a light area rug is a great way to brighten up the space and make it seem more Airy.
If you're not sure what color area rug to use with grey flooring, you can always play it safe with a neutral shade like white, cream, or beige. These colors will go well with any type of grey and won't clash with your other decor.
When it comes topatterns, there are endless possibilities. However, if you want your rug to really stand out, we recommend choosing a bold geometric print or a colorful stripe. These patterns will add interest to your space and complement the grey floors perfectly.
No matter what color or pattern you choose, make sure to select an area rug that's the right size for your room. If it's too small, it will look out of place and make the room seem cramped. Conversely, if it's too large, it will overwhelm the space. The best way to determine the perfect size is to measure your room and then add about 2 feet to each side of the rug.

What color paint should I use if I have grey flooring?
There are a few things to consider when choosing a paint color if you have grey flooring. The first is the undertone of your grey flooring. Is your flooring on the cooler side with blue or violet undertones? Or is it on the warmer side with brown or red undertones? You'll want to choose a paint color that complements the undertone of your flooring.
If your grey flooring has cool undertones, you might want to choose a pale blue or lavender paint color. If your grey flooring has warmer undertones, a light orange or pink might be a good choice. You could also go for a white paint color, which would work well with both cool and warm undertones.
The second thing to consider is the amount of light in your room. If you have a lot of natural light, you can go for a darker paint color. If your room is on the darker side, you'll want to choose a lighter paint color.
If you're still not sure what color to paint your walls, you could always sample a few colors on your wall to see what looks best in your space.
